CHA! HOISIN-GLAZED ROASTED CHICKEN WINGS INSTRUCTIONS

Making these spicy hot wings is incredibly easy and fairly quick. In fact, the actual ‘active’ part of making them takes maybe ten minutes. It’s the marinating and the roasting that take the longest.

Since the wings need to marinate for 24 hours, I’ll do mine the night before while I am making that evenings meal. All you have to do is toss them in a bowl, add the sauce and let them sit in the fridge. Then the next day, simply roast them and mix up the glaze.

STEP ONE: MARINATE

  1. Add wings to large mixing bowl and cover them with CHA! Sauce
  2. Cover and put in fridge for 24 hours.

STEP TWO: SEASON

  1. The next day, melt butter and pour over wings.
  2. Season with salt and pepper.

STEP THREE: ROAST

  1. Place wings on as many baking trays as needed, keeping space between each one and not over-crowding the pans.
  2. Roast in preheated oven (400F), flipping once, for approximately 45 mins – 1 hour 15 mins.

STEP FOUR: PREP THE GLAZE

  1. Slice scallions.
  2. Combine the remaining CHA! with the hoisin sauce and mix well.

STEP FOUR: TOSS AND SERVE

  1. Carefully place cooked wings in large mixing bowl, cover with sauce, and toss until completely combined.
  2. Arrange wings on serving platter and garnish with scallions.

CHA! Hoisin-Glazed Roasted Chicken Wings

CHA! HOISIN-GLAZED ROASTED CHICKEN WINGS on black cutting board

Tender and juicy chicken wings are roasted to perfection then covered in a spicy hoisin sauce and sprinkles with scallions in this CHA! Hoisin-Glazed Chicken Wings recipe.

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 1 hour
Marinating Time 1 day
Total Time 1 day 1 hour 10 minutes

Ingredients

For the Wings

  • 4 lbs (48 wings) chicken party wings, fresh
  • 1 stick butter, salted
  • 1 cup CHA! by Texas Pete®
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

For the Glaze

  • ½ cup CHA! by Texas Pete® 
  • ¾ cup Hoisin sauce
  • 1 bunch scallions, sliced thin for garnish

Instructions

For The Chicken Wings

  1. Marinate the chicken wings in the CHA! by Texas Pete® for 24 hours.
  2. Preheat the oven to 400 degrees Fahrenheit.
  3. Once marinated, place the chicken wings in a large mixing bowl.
  4. Melt the stick of butter and pour over the chicken wings.
  5. Season with salt and pepper and mix well.
  6. Place the chicken wings on baking trays, making sure to keep space between them and not over-crowding the pans.
  7. Roast the chicken wings for approximately 45 minutes or until golden brown, crispy, fork tender and fully cooked to an internal temperature of 165 degrees. Depending upon the size of the wings, this may take over an hour.
  8. Flip them once halfway through the cooking process so they crisp evenly on both sides.


For The Glaze

  1. While wings are roasting, slice the scallions and prepare the glaze.
  2. Combine the CHA! by Texas Pete® with the hoisin sauce and mix well.


Putting It All Together

  1. Once chicken wings are finished cooking, carefully place them into a large mixing bowl and toss them with the spicy CHA! hoisin glaze.
  2. Arrange the chicken wings on a serving platter, garnish with the sliced scallions, and serve.
